> > I created Chirality restraints file using makeCHIR_RST code in Amber. In
> > amber manual there is a line "Note that you may have to edit the output
> of
> > this program to change trans peptide constraints to cis, as appropriate."
> > Is this note is for proline?
>
> Yes: if you know you have a cis-proline, you certainly don't want to have a
> trans restraint. If you don't know whether your proline is cis or trans,
> you
> probably don't want to have any restraint. In either case, you need to
> hand-edit the output of makeCHIR_RST to do what you want (e.g. delete some
> of
> the restraints.)
